Best Korean Restaurants in London as Recommended by Locals

Last Updated: Apr 7, 2023 · Author: Victoria Yap ·

With the rising influence of K-culture, more Korean restaurants are popping up all over London and it’s time you tried out some of the city’s best offerings!

London’s food scene is world-renowned and famous for its many eclectic flavours and styles. This cosmopolitan metropolis draws inspiration from all over the world, which is why the best Korean restaurants in London offer the most authentic food that you’ll find outside of Seoul. But which are the best?

Arirang

Arirang Korean bbq beef stew
Delectable Korean BBQ with a side of lettuce and beef stew from Arirang | Image from Instagram

Arirang has the notable distinction of being both the oldest Korean restaurant in London and one of the best Korean restaurants in the UK.

If you find yourself in England’s cosmopolitan capital, stop in for their ginseng chicken soup or beef bulgogi, a house favourite consisting of perfectly marinated and cooked strips of beef. Located near Oxford Circus Underground in central London, Arirang is not to be missed!

Arirang
31-32 Poland St, London W1F 8QT

Korean BBQ & Vegan

Korean bbq and vegan bibimpap
Beautifully presented bibimbap from Korean BBQ and Vegan | Image from Instagram

If you love Korean BBQ and are also a vegetarian or vegan, this halal, HMC-certified restaurant is perfect for you. Korean BBQ & Vegan has incredible spins on all of your favourite Korean dishes like bibimbap and kimchi so that you can get your fix of authentic Korean flavours without the meat.

Korean BBQ & Vegan
107 Whitecross St, London EC1Y 8JD

Hongdae Pocha

Hongdae pocha's corn cheese, cheese buldak, and odeng tang
Irresistible Korean corn cheese, Cheese buldak (Spicy chicken), and odeng tang (Fish cake) from Hongdae Pocha | Image from Instagram

Hongdae Pocha is one of the best Korean restaurants in London with a fantastic ambience and homestyle feel that is part restaurant and part pub. 

Try their Korean fried chicken and various types of hot pots. All of their food pairs perfectly with Hongdae Pocha’s menu of pub drinks and fresh cold beers. This is the spot to try a soju bomb with your friends.

Hongdae Pocha
26 Romilly St, London W1D 5AJ

Assa

Assa Ramen hotpot with beef and spam
Delicious spicy hot pot with spam, ramen and beef |Image from Instagram

If you’re looking for a fantastic hot pot right in London’s Soho district, Assa is an excellent choice. You’ll get your fix of the hot, delicious, comfort food made with homemade sausage, beans, and a hearty helping of instant noodles.

Assa tends to get pretty busy, so remember to pack your patience as well as your appetite.

Assa
23 Romilly St, London W1D 5AG

Jumak39

Jumak39 Ojingeo Bokeum Squid
Ojingeo Bokeum (Stir-fried spicy squid & assorted vegetables) | Image from Jumak39

Located in Central London, Jumak39 is best known for its offering of traditional Korean food and a great selection of Korean BBQ plates.

Try their authentic Jjambong made with thin Chinese noodles and flavourful seafood soup. Or if you're feeling adventurous, order yourself a Soondae Bokeum (Stir-fried Korean style black pudding with assorted vegetables)!

Jumak39
39 Panton Street, London SW1Y 4EA

On the Bab

On the bab's fried chicken combination makes it the best Korean restaurant in London
Absolutely breathtaking fried chicken from On the Bab | Image from Instagram

On the Bab's claim to fame is its ability to pair Korean street food with classic cocktails for an immersive, delicious, and exciting dining experience. It also serves up some of the best Korean fried chicken in the city.

Split an order of their prawn buns or seaweed salad for a memorable meal with friends. 

On the Bab
Across London

Haru

Haru Budae Jjigae
Budae Jjigae (Army Stew) and an assortment of dishes from Haru in New Malden | Image from Lennard Lim

Highly recommended by locals, Haru stands out among the restaurants in London's little Korea town.

Haru's homely, family-style dishes are described by frequent patrons as delicious and impossible to not enjoy them. Customers often find themselves ordering more than they originally planned because Haru makes sure every dish shines through with an abundance of taste and aroma.

Haru
50 High St, New Malden KT3 4EZ

Jin Go Gae

Jin Go Gae Kalguksu Seafood spicy broth with flat noodles and egg
Spicy seafood Kalguksu (Korean knife-cut noodle soup) from Jin Go Gae | Image from Instagram

Jin Go Gae is the best Korean restaurant in New Malden, focusing on authenticity and flavour. It’s famous for its incredible soups and spice-laced broths. You can customize most of your orders too. Jin Go Gae is a fantastic option if you’re looking for simply tasty, authentic, and affordable Korean cuisine. 

Jin Go Gae
272 Burlington Rd, New Malden KT3 4NL

Dotori

Dotori Japchae
Tasty Japchae (Stir-fried glass noodles) from Dotori | Image from Instagram

Dotori specializes in a fusion mix of Japanese and Korean food, with expertly-prepared dishes and total mastery of both types of flavours.

As a bonus, the food at Dotori is reasonably priced. Try their stir-fried rice heaped with vegetables and meat, Korean BBQ, or fish cakes with gochujang sauce.

Dotori
3 Stroud Green Rd, Finsbury Park, London N4 2DQ

Koba

Koba KimchiJjigae
Try Koba's Kimchi jjigae (Kimchi stew) with tofu and a side of rice | Image from Instagram

For one of the best Korean restaurants in London, head to the city’s Fitzrovia district for a high-end, authentic experience that will satisfy even the pickiest eaters.

Koba specializes in beef kalbi, bulgogi, and barbequed meats and fish. All of their dishes are perfectly balanced and served with ample amounts of rice.

Koba
11 Rathbone St, London W1T 1NA

Olle Korean Barbecue

If you like your Korean food with a side of entertainment, check out Olle Korean Barbecue. At this restaurant, you’ll get a show right at your table.

Olle Sundubu Jjigae
Olle Korean Barbecue's delectable Spicy Sundubu Jjigae (soft tofu stew) | Image from Instagram

Servers prepare bulgogi, barbecue, and other Korean favourites right in front of your eyes. Pair your barbeque with savoury pancakes, bibimbap, and noodles for a satisfying meal.

Olle Korean Barbecue
88 Shaftesbury Ave, London W1D 6NG
